Abstract
The humanity viewpoint on search engine is put forward. In this paper, we analyze that the individual interest in the same interest group exists a certain comparability, and the same interest community is that they together concern about the same topic found out. In the process of search Web information, the regular grammar based on logically uncertain reasoning is constituted. Making use of the regular grammar including the URLs recommend the sequence that is the interviewing interest topic of user is its head, and the URLs of the relevant the interest topic of the another user is the other nodes. Experiment and analysis further demonstrate the feasibility of such an approach.
